Celebrity nanny and parenting expert, Jo Frost, was in L.A. recently to spread the word about the importance of staying active and being healthy. Her visit was part of EIB Active, a national campaign started in 2010 to raise awareness about exercise-induced bronchospasm, or E-I-B, a breathing condition affecting nine out of ten children and adults living with asthma, and an estimated 30 million people in the United States. An estimated 4.9 million Californians are currently living with asthma, including one in six children under the age of 18. As part of the event, children and their families had the chance to get screened for asthma and EIB through the Asthma and Allergy Foundation of America's (AAFA) Breathmobile®.
